Diwali is being celebrated across the country. Today is Dhanteras, marking the beginning of the five-day Diwali festival. Diwali is considered a special occasion for worshipping Goddess Lakshmi and Lord Vishnu. On this day, people perform rituals to seek Goddess Lakshmi's blessings throughout the year. While special rituals are performed to appease Goddess Lakshmi and Lord Vishnu on Diwali, astrology also considers a special coconut ritual performed on the night before Diwali to be extremely auspicious. It is believed that an unbroken coconut used in the havan (fire sacrifice) should be brought home on the eve of Diwali. After this, on the day of Diwali, during the Brahma Muhurta (divine time), without informing anyone, bathe the coconut in a pond or river near your home. Doing so pleases Goddess Lakshmi, and wealth, good fortune, and prosperity reside permanently in the home.

According to Ayodhya's astrologer, Pandit Kalki Ram, at sunset on Diwali, the sacred coconut should be wrapped in a clean cloth and worshipped as per the prescribed rituals. After the puja, it is considered auspicious to place the coconut in the safe or the place where you keep your money. It is believed that doing so bestows the special blessings of Goddess Lakshmi, increases wealth in the home, and maintains financial prosperity throughout the year. Also, on Diwali, when you light a lamp and worship Lord Ganesha and Goddess Lakshmi, keep that special coconut at your place of worship. Apply a tilak on it during the puja and worship it as per the prescribed rituals. Pray to Goddess Lakshmi to fulfill all your wishes and ensure that your home remains filled with happiness and prosperity. After the puja, keep the coconut at your place of worship for 24 hours, as per Vastu Shastra. The next day, remove it and place it in your safe or other place where you keep your money. It is believed that following this remedy ensures prosperity throughout the year, and Goddess Lakshmi resides permanently in your home.
